Ninja Warrior Germany All-Stars 2 was the second installment of Ninja Warrior Germany's All-Stars competition, which premiered on April 22th, 2022 at RTL. This time, 1400 of the best competitors of Ninja Warrior Germany, with 160 competitors per Preliminary Round episode, participated across 5 Preliminary Round episodes and one Finals episode.

Competition Format[]
- Preliminary Rounds - Round 1:
- There were 32 participants (24 males and 8 females; except Episode 4 in which all 32 participants were males) at the start each Preliminary Rounds episode, with each of them participating against another oppenent in a direct 1vs1, Ninja vs. Ninja duel parkour. 16 duels (12 for males and 4 for females; except Episode 4 in which all 16 duels were for males) and 16 advancing participants in total.
- The participants of each duel would be determined by a random system.
- The winning participant of a direct duel would advance to the second Preliminary Round.
- The participant who completed the course with the best clear time out of all the winning participants who completed the course would receive a cash prize of 5,000€.
- Preliminary Rounds - Round 2:
- In the second Preliminary Round, each of the 16 remaining participants (12 males and 4 females; except Episode 4 in which all 16 participants were males) would once again participate against another oppenent in a direct 1vs1, Ninja vs. Ninja duel parkour. 8 duels (6 for males and 2 for females; except Episode 4 in which all 8 duels were for males) and 8 advancing participants in total.
- The winning participant of a direct duel would advance to the third, and final, Preliminary Round.
- Preliminary Rounds - Round 3:
- In the third, and final Preliminary Round, each of the now 8 remaining participants (6 males and 2 females; except Episode 4 in which all 8 participants were males) would participate against another oppenent in a duel on the Power Tower. 4 duels (3 for males and one for females; except Episode 4 in which all 4 duels were for males) and 4 advancing participants in total.
- The winning participant of a Power Tower duel would advance to the Finals.
- Finals - Round 1:
- In the first round of the Finals, each of the 20 remaining participants (16 males and 4 females), who managed to win all of their Preliminary Rounds duels, would participate against another opponent in a direct 1vs1, Ninja vs. Ninja duel parkour. 10 duels (8 for males and 2 for females) and 10 advancing participants in total.
- The participants of each duel would be determined by a random system.
- The winning participant of a direct duel would advance to the second Round of the Finals.
- Finals - Round 2:
- In the second round of the Finals, each of the now 10 remaining participants (8 males and 2 females), who managed to win all of their Preliminary Rounds duels and their first Finals duel, would, once again participate against another oppenent in a direct 1vs1, Ninja vs. Ninja duel pakour. 5 duels (4 for males and one for females) and 5 advancing participants in total.
- The winning participant of a direct duel would advance to the third Round of the Finals, the Super Salmon Ladder (Endlose Himmelsleiter').
- Finals - Round 3 (The Super Salmon Ladder):
- In the third round of the Finals, the now 5 remaining participants (4 males and one female), who managed to win all of their Preliminary Rounds duels and their first Finals duels, would have to attempt the Super Salmon Ladder (Endlose Himmelsleiter').
- This Salmon Ladder would consist of 35 rungs in total.
- Out of the 5 remaining participants, the 2 best/fastest would advance to the fourth and final Round of the Finals, the final duel of Ninja Warrior Germany All-Stars.
- Finals - Round 4 (The Final Duel):
- In this fourth, and final round of the Finals of Ninja Warrior Germany All-Stars, the now 2 remaining participants would participate against against each other in one final duel on the Power Tower.
- The winning participant of this final duel, not matter if the participant is male or female, would be crowned as the winner of Ninja Warrior Germany All-Stars and of a 50,000€ cash prize.
- If no female participant would manage to win the entire competition, said participant would receive the Last Woman Standing cash prize of 25,000€.

*Notable Occurence[]
During a later video footage review of the situation stated in the duel between Sladjan Djulabic and Benjamin Schmidt-Markurt, it was revealed that Schmidt-Markurt's foot pushed the safety mat which then caused water droplets of the ripple to get on his foot. Since the rules for this were not precisely defined in the official regulations of the show, there was no possible definite ruling for it. But since this case was deemed as controversial by several of the other competitors, the referees decided to rule in favor of both athletes, so Sladjan Djulabic (the loser of the duel) was allowed to advance to the Super Salmon Ladder as well.
